Understanding Analysis Results

Once your analysis job is complete, ClusterHawk provides results through the Analysis Results page. This page offers a detailed view of your analysis output with various tabs and visualizations to help you interpret the data.

How ClusterHawk analyzes your data
  • Group similar IPs: ClusterHawk clusters IP addresses that behave alike (similar services, products, certificates, etc.).
  • Summarize what defines each group: It highlights the key characteristics that make a cluster unique.
  • Track change over time: It compares today's clusters with earlier jobs to see what stayed stable and what moved.
  • Surface unusual items: It flags outliers, sudden changes, and suspicious movement patterns.
Quick way to read the results
  • Start with Cluster Distribution: Big, consistent clusters usually represent stable infrastructure; tiny or fragmented clusters may be niche or newly emerging.
  • Open Cluster Features: Read the top features like you would a fingerprint: these explain what actually binds the IPs together.
  • Use Neighborhood Analysis: Look for what changed since previous jobs: new neighbors, lost neighbors, or mass movements between clusters.
  • Review Anomalies: Outliers, sudden drops in stability, or isolated IPs often point to interesting investigations.
